    Well as someone who has had the full OME lift, I would say the main difference as stated by myself and others regarding these two scenarios comes down to adjustability. The Toytec will allow for infinite adjustability anywhere up to 3". With OME , once you select the coil- what you get is what you get, done deal.

    I have a set of OME for sale as well but I would say its a no brainer for the Toytec coilovers. Your mileage may vary but that's my experience.
